Unlike studio photography, nature dictates the schedule. A wildlife photographer might spend weeks in a sub-zero blind just to capture the moment a Siberian tiger breaks through the treeline. This dedication is what elevates a photograph from a mere snapshot to a masterpiece. The "art" lies in the photographer's ability to anticipate behavior and use natural light—the golden hour glow or the moody blue of twilight—to evoke emotion. Technical Mastery Meets Creative Vision

Increasingly, contemporary nature art moves beyond realism into abstraction. British artist Hannah Bullen-Ryner creates massive cyanotypes using found feathers and ferns — no camera, just light and shadow. Her work feels both ancient and urgent, as if the forest is printing its own memory.
